Lawyer Questions Mediator's Loyalties, Experience

Canada’s Teacher Dispute Saga Continues
The Vancouver Sun
June 8, 2012
Teacher’s dispute in Canada has been going on for month. A lawyer for the teacher’s union suggest that the mediator is an advocate for the government “rather than a skilled negotiator who can help both sides reach a deal.” There is not a motion to quash the mediator’s appointment based on the mediator Charles Jago’s bias and inexperience as a mediator. Government attorney says, “Such a challenge should only be made on the basis of objective evidence that rises above speculation” and the evidence in this situation doesn’t.
